Protein Description

ME3 (malic enzyme 3) is a crucial enzyme involved in metabolic processes, particularly in the regulation of energy production and signaling pathways. It catalyzes the oxidative decarboxylation of malate to pyruvate, a reaction that plays a significant role in both mitochondrial metabolism and cytosolic pathways, influencing cellular respiration and anabolic processes. Research into ME3 has gained momentum due to its potential implications in various physiological and pathological conditions, including cancer metabolism, obesity, and neurodegenerative diseases. Dysregulation of ME3 expression and activity has been linked to altered metabolic states, highlighting its importance as a metabolic regulator. Recent studies have focused on the structural and functional characterization of ME3, utilizing recombinant protein techniques to produce and analyze the enzyme. Understanding the mechanisms by which ME3 operates at a molecular level could pave the way for novel therapeutic strategies aimed at correcting metabolic imbalances in diseases. Additionally, exploring the role of ME3 in different tissues may reveal its versatility and necessity in maintaining cellular homeostasis. Thus, the investigation of ME3 as a recombinant protein is not only crucial for basic biochemical research but also offers significant insights into its potential as a target for therapeutic intervention in metabolic disorders.
